Have you ever wanted to be a BookTuber? Now you can! Join library staff at Central Park to star in a short book talk telling our patrons why they should read one of your favorite books! Each video will be professionally filmed by CCPL staff.
What is a book talk? It's a short, original teaser in your own words that will make everyone else want to read the book. Each book talk should be 30 seconds to 1 minute long. New books published in 2020 or 2021 are encouraged. Bring a physical copy of the book(s) if you can, and feel free to bring notes as a reference. An easy way to use notes in the video is to tape them to the back of the book. You may also bring small props that go along with your book or cosplay as one of your favorite characters from the book! You can even bring a friend to book talk the same title together in the same video.
